This photograph captures the majestic Tomb of Mastino II, located in Piazzaletto delle Arche, Verona. The tomb stands as a testament to the Gothic architecture prevalent during the Middle Ages in Europe. Dating back to 1345, this funerary monument is a remarkable example of Christian artistry and craftsmanship. The image showcases the intricate details of the tomb's column, building elements, decoration, and sections. Each element contributes to its overall grandeur and significance. The structure itself resembles an ark or a sacred vessel that holds great spiritual meaning within Christian religion. Fernando Pasta skillfully captured this timeless masterpiece around 1930. His lens brings out every nuance of the sculpture's delicate features while highlighting its enduring beauty despite being centuries old.
